Vehicles Included
For vehicles aged over 3 years, an annual MOT test is mandatory to ensure roadworthiness. While Class 4 tests typically cover personal cars and small vans, Class 7 tests are essential for light commercial vehicles weighing between 3 tonnes and 3.5 tonnes. It's worth noting that the Class 4 category also encompasses motorhomes weighing up to 3.5 tonnes.

What Constitutes a Class 7 MOT Check? A Class 7 MOT is specifically for commercial vehicles with a gross weight ranging from 3,000kg to 3,500kg, whereas commercial cars and smaller vans fall under Class 4 MOT requirements. If unsure about your vehicle's required test, consult your vehicle handbook or V5 registration document for clarification.
Difference Between Class 4 & 7
While Class 7 MOT tests share similarities with Class 4, they involve slightly more thorough inspections for larger vehicles. Additional aspects examined in a Class 7 test include tire suitability for bearing extra weight and enhanced brake efficiency tests to ensure heightened safety standards.
